The ratings on La Banque Postale are based on the bank's position as a highly integrated core subsidiary of La Poste (AA-/Stable/A-1+). They also take into account an adequate stand-alone position--resulting from a strong franchise in the domestic retail market, a low risk profile, superior liquidity, and a sound capital position--balanced by weak efficiency ratios, and revenues and diversification below peers'. The ratings on La Poste reflect the company's 100% state ownership, as well as its specific status, which is viewed by Standard&Poor's Ratings Services as implying an ultimate statutory guarantee from the Republic of France (AAA/Stable/A-1+) on La Poste's financial obligations.
